Poison Creek Campground, located in Lake Cascade State Park near Donnelly, Idaho, offers a serene getaway with stunning views of Lake Cascade and the surrounding mountains. The campground is well-maintained, featuring clean facilities, spacious sites with full hookups, and a beautiful beach area. It's an ideal spot for outdoor enthusiasts, providing easy access to activities like swimming, fishing, and boating. The nearby town of Donnelly offers additional amenities and supplies, making it a convenient base for exploring the area.

Visitors appreciate the friendly atmosphere, though some note that camp hosts can be strict. The campground is accessible year-round, with winter camping options available in designated areas.

The scenic backdrop and variety of recreational activities make Poison Creek Campground a popular choice for both short and extended stays.

Poison Creek Campground offers a range of amenities to enhance the camping experience. The campground features clean restrooms, showers, and picnic areas, along with full hookups for RVs, including water, sewer, and electric connections. Additionally, there are ADA-compliant sites available, ensuring accessibility for all visitors. Fire rings and picnic tables are provided at each site, and firewood is available for purchase. The nearby marina offers boat rentals, allowing campers to enjoy Lake Cascade's waters.

The campground also includes a group shelter that can be reserved, making it suitable for larger gatherings.

Poison Creek Campground is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. The campground's proximity to Lake Cascade allows for swimming, fishing, and boating. Visitors can rent kayaks, canoes, or motorized boats from the nearby marina. The surrounding area offers hiking and mountain biking trails, providing opportunities to explore the scenic landscape. For those interested in water sports, the nearby North Fork of the Payette River offers world-class white water rafting and kayaking.

The campground itself is a great spot for relaxation, with its beautiful beach area and tranquil surroundings.

Parking at Poison Creek Campground is convenient, with drive-in sites available for campers. The campground also offers a boat ramp with a parking lot, which is open year-round. During winter, parking is available in designated areas for those camping in the boat ramp parking lots. While there may be limited parking for day-use visitors, the campground's layout ensures that most campers can park near their sites.

The proximity of parking areas to the beach and amenities makes it easy for visitors to access the lake and other facilities.

A fun fact about Lake Cascade is its extensive shoreline, stretching over 86 miles, providing ample opportunities for boating and fishing. The lake is known for its diverse fish species, including Rainbow Trout and Coho Salmon.
